Quote from oraclewizard77:
Keep a chart of all your trades in excel.
This should then allow to then run calculations like win%, number of winners and number of losers.
This can also tell you total profit amount and total loss amount.
It can also allow you write thoughts next to your trades.
I usually will write why I am taking the trade, if I won or loss, and then summary of what went right or wrong.
I also will end of day, write what I thought of day. It may help you see a common mistake you keep making to improve your win%.
Also, many programs like ninja trader and trade station have reports that you can generate that will provide many good statistics for you.
Quote from intradaybill:
No, it's not he profit factor. the Edge is well-defined and equal to how much your system has won on average:
Edge = avg. win x success rate - avg. loss ( 1- success rate)
Easy to calculate with excel.
The edge divided by the avg. win is the optimal bet size. Ask any gambler. See this paper for details.
